Plot
Jayantilal "Ratan" Pandey () is a ruthless . ACP Sanjay Path "S. P." Malhotra () arrests him. Ratan wounds himself and is taken to the hospital, where ACP Malhotra is waiting for his wife Geeta Malhotra (), who is in labor. She gives birth to twins. The doctor explains that both babies have a reflection mentality, which means that "what happens with one baby might be felt and reflected by another," depending on the proximity between them. Ratan escapes and takes one of the twins with him, injuring Geeta. ACP Malhotra chases after him. Unable to find his son, shoots a fleeing Ratan in an attempt to stop him. The kid grows up as Raja (, then ) and finds a girl, Neelam whom he adopts as his sister. He finds another , Rangeela Prakash (, then ) and becomes his friend. Together they take care of the girl and become small-time .

On the other hand, Geeta goes into depression and gets paralyzed. ACP Malhotra takes her to the for her treatment, where the other twin named Prem Malhotra (also Salman Khan) is brought up. He comes to as a rock star for a show. He is received by Kishan Sharma (), who is his father's friend and wishes to marry his daughter Mala Sharma () to him. But Mala is in love with Raja. At the airport, Prem finds Roopa Batwani (Rambha), daughter of Sundari Batwani (Bindu), the organizer of his public shows. Prem falls in love with Roopa. Tony (), Sundari's nephew, also wishes to marry Roopa. Meanwhile, Mala misunderstands Prem for Raja and starts flirting with him. One day, Raja and Prem see each other in a restaurant and find out that they are identical, which leads to hilarious misunderstandings.

Meanwhile, Raja's sister Neelam (Sheetal Joshi) sees local goon Ratanlal "Tiger" Pandey () who is the son of Ratan, killing an Inspector on the road and becomes a vital witness of the murder in court. Enraged, Tiger assaults and threatens her to not report his crime to the police. However, as a consequence, Tiger is badly beaten up by Raja, making him more vengeful against Raja and Neelam. To exact his revenge, he sends his henchman named Tommy (Shashi Kiran) to be the groom of Neelam but Raja and Rangeela find out his plan and marry Neelam to someone else. The court announces the death sentence to Tiger for the murder of the Inspector he shot earlier. Days pass, Neelam becomes pregnant, and she is admitted to a hospital for her delivery. Raja asks Prem to stay at the hospital as he is searching for money. Prem visits his father, ACP Malhotra. At the same time, Tiger escapes from jail to kidnap Neelam and recognizes ACP Malhotra, who shot his father Ratan and finds out that Raja is his son. He blackmails Raja to get ACP Malhotra to free Neelam. Raja, who does not know that ACP Malhotra is his real father goes to his house where Geeta also comes out from the paralysis by Raja's touch, and he comes to see the truth that they are his real parents and Prem is his twin brother. Finally, Raja and Prem come together to protect their father from Tiger. Raja finds out about his and prem's shared reflex, Nandu requests Raja to beat him so Prem would beat Tiger. And the story ends with the duo marrying their respective ladies.

Reboot
On 9 February 2016, a reboot to the film, titled Judwaa 2, was announced. The film is once again directed by and produced by and features David's son in the leading double role. The trailer of Judwaa 2 was unveiled to audiences on 21 August 2017 and the film was released on 29 September 2017. The only cast members from the original Judwaa appearing in Judwaa 2 are Anupam Kher, albeit in a different role, and Salman Khan in a cameo appearance, while the only songs recreated from the original "Judwaa" were the famous "Oonchi Hai Building (Lift Teri Bandh Hai)" and "Tan Tana Tan Tan Tan Tara (Chalti Hai Kya 9 Se 12)".
